Chorus
E:--------------------------
B:--------------------------
G:-12-----12-----12-----12--
D:-10-----12-----10-----9---
A:-8------10-----10-----10--
D:--------------------------
i stop at
E:----
B:----
G:12-
D:12-
A:10-
D:----
